High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les! Most of the many languages of Europe belong to the Indo-European language family. Another major family is the Finno-Ugric. The Turkic family also has several European members. The North and South Caucasian families are important in the southeastern extremity of geographical Europe. Basque is a language isolate and Maltese is the only national language in Europe, but not the only language, that is Semitic. This list does not include languages spoken by relatively recently-arrived migrant communities.
